3. 3 axis Non Contact Measurement System www visioneng com support OPERATION amp SETUP Main system controls Zoom Control Surface Illumination Iris Control Substage Illumination Iris Control Y Axis Control X Axis Control 6 Fine Z Axis Rocker Control On off switch Camera gain control www visioneng com support Falcon 3 axis Non Contact Measurement System 5 HOW TO USE YOUR FALCON MEASURING SYSTEM Start up Switch on the Falcon the ringlight power supply and the QC 300 D After the start up screen has displayed on the QC 300 follow the on screen instructions and pass the reference marks in all three axis gt Select the Light tab on the screen and adjust the illumination by selecting the icon and adjusting the intensity via the slidebar P Move the zoom to the desired position and focus on the subject by moving the head up or down using the switch at the front of the stand To achieve optimum results from your Falcon measuring system illumination and optics need to be optimised to provide the best possible image Certain lighting configurations are better for some applications than others Substage illumination should be used for profile measurement optional colour filter available whilst surface illumination is for subjects with surface features Illumination and focus should be adjusted until the image is clear and bright with good contrast Maximum contrast improves accuracy and repeatability

Contact your nearest Vision Engineering branch or Distributor if you require further information Iris controls The camera and substage are fitted with a 5 position 1 4 and Z adjustable iris 1 2 small 5 or Z large allowing the user to change the aperture of the lens Changing the position of the controls results in the iris opening and closing This changes the amount of light passing back through the lens slightly increasing or decreasing the depth of field ideal for subjects where greater surface definition is required Position Z is used for height measurement The Iris on the substage is used to give sharper edge definition on profiles of 3 dimensional subjects Objective lens Magnification table Total System n Part No Description Zoom Ratio Magnification Working Distance Field of View F 003 Low Magnitication 1 5x 10x 50x 91mm 2 7 13 5mm Objective F 004 High Magnification 1 5x 20x 100x 61mm 1 35 6 75mm Objective Illumination options Substage Substage illumination used for the accurate measurement of through holes profiles and edge features Adjust the intensity firstly by selecting the Substage icon from the Light toolbar then by moving the marker up or down the slidebar Can be used in conjunction with the surface illumination Archive Program Y Measure zm Falcon 3 axis Non Contact Measurement System www visioneng com suppor

10. ight and Offset crosslines used for manually taking points not used by Falcon Single Edge tool for capturing single points on a feature Multi Edge tool for capturing multiple points on a feature either inside or outside the field of view Points are captured by aligning the tool over the edge of the feature being measured and pressing enter to register the point Points can be automatically captured by leaving the tool stationary over the feature for a preset time seconds The multiedge tool is used to capture multiple points either inside or outside the field of view For inside the field of view position the tool in the centre of the feature being measured press enter to fire the points For features outside the field of view take three points circle or 2 points line and follow the green arrow to capture the remaining number of points the number of points can be increased decreased if required Measuring features The following geometric features can be measured Point measured by capturing a single point Line measured by capturing a minimum of two points Circle measured by capturing a minimum of three points Slot measured by capturing five points C 72 If you wish to measure the form of a feature it is best to take at least 8 points to achieve a better result EH Falcon 3 axis Non Contact Measurement System www visioneng com support HOW TO USE YOUR FALCON MEASURING SYSTEM Mea

16. t HOW TO USE YOUR FALCON MEASURING SYSTEM Ringlight surface Surface illumination is used for surface features and blind holes etc Adjust the intensity firstly by selecting the Ringlight icon from the Light toolbar then by moving the marker up or down the slidebar Archive Program Y Measure For difficult to see edges each quadrant can be switched on yellow and off blank as required by selecting the required quadrant just touch the screen on the segment required Switching quadrants off can create a shadow used to increase the contrast of low contrast edges Can be used in conjunction with the surface illumination Best practice To ensure the most accurate measurements are taken it is recommended that during the measurement process these following guidelines are followed Do not adjust Magnification Do not adjust camera or substage iris once image has been optimized Do not lean on or shake upper arm of your Falcon product When measuring subjects in the Z axis it is recommended that the approach direction to achieve clear focus is the same for both references When viewing subject to locate measurement feature it is recommended that the Falcon is focussed at max magnification then select lower mag if required The Falcon Z axis is controlled by a highly sensitive variable speed switch This has been incorporated into the instrument in an intuitive ergonomic position ideal for righ
17. t or left handed use see opposite Light pressure on the switch will result in extremely fine adjustment of the Z axis enabling accurate repeatable focussing As pressure on the switch is increased the focussing adjustment speed will also increase Select the correct magnification for the component being measured based on size of component and field of view see magnification table on page 12 Ensure that the lens has been calibrated and selected on the QC 300 see QC 300 user guide for details Focus on the subject using the control at the front of the stand to move the head then move the zoom control to the desired position To achieve the very best from your Falcon non contact measuring system you should carry out regular routine maintenance as well as undertaking a schedule of service and calibration see service and calibration record at the end of this user guide Camera gain control Your Falcon System is fitted with camera auto gain control This can be deactivated by using switch on front of control box This feature is useful when viewing low contrast parts with high levels of illumination or when taking profile measurements with sub stage illumination E www visioneng com supportt Falcon 3 axis Non Contact Measurement System HOW TO USE YOUR FALCON MEASURING SYSTEM Taking basic measurements Measurements can be made using any one of the four capture tools Touch the screen to display the options Stra
